CYBERCRIMES (PROHIBITION, PREVENTION, ETC) AMENDMENT ACT, 2024

Section 58: Interpretation

In this Act
"access" means gaining entry into, instructing or communicating with the logical, arithmetical, or memory function resources of a computer system or network;
"Access Device" includes electronic cards such as-
(a) Debit Cards;
(b) Credit Cards;
(c) Charge Cards;
(d) Loyalty Cards;
(e) Magnetic Stripe Based Cards;
(f) Smart Chip Based cards;
(g) EMV Cards;
(h) Passwords;
(i) Personal Identification Number (PIN);
(j) Electronic Plate;
(k) Electronic Serial Number;
(l) Code Number;
(m) Mobile Identification Number;
(n) any account number or other telecommunications service, equipment, or instrument identifier, or other means of account access including telephones, PDAs, etc.;
(o) Automatic Teller Machines;
(p) Point of Sales Terminals; and
(q) other vending machines;

"ATM" means Automated Teller Machine.

"authorised access" means a person has authorised access to any program or data held in a computer if-
(a) the person is entitled to control access to the program or data in question; or
(b) the person has consent to access such program or data from a person who is charged with granting such consent;

"Authorised Manufacturer" means a financial institution which, or any other person who, is authorised under any written law to produce a card;

"authorised officer" or authorised persons" means a member of any law enforcement agency or a person mandated by it, involved in the prohibition, prevention, elimination or combating of computer crimes and cyber security threats;

"Bank Card" means any instrument, token, device, or card whether known as a bank service card, banking card, cheque guarantee card, or debit card or by any other similar name, issued with or without a fee by an issuer for the use of the cardholder in obtaining goods, services, or anything else of value or for the use in automated banking device to obtain money or any of the services offered through the device;

"Card" means a bank card, credit card, or payment card;

"Cardholder" means the person named on the face of a bank card, credit card or payment card to whom or for whose benefit such a card is issued by an issuer;

"Card Making Equipment" means any equipment, machine, plate, mechanism, impression, or any other device designed, used, or capable of being used to produce a card, a counterfeit card, or any aspect or component of a card;

"Computer" means an electronic, magnetic, optical, electrochemical or other high speed data processing device performing logical, arithmetic, or storage functions and includes any data storage facility and all communication devices that can directly interface with a computer through communication protocols but it excludes portable hand held calculator, typewriters and typesetters or other similar devices;

"computer data" includes every information required by the computer to be able to operate, run programs, store programs and store information that the computer user needs such as text files or other files that are associated with the program the computer user is running.

"computer program" or "program" means a set of instructions written to perform or execute a specified task with a computer;

"computer system"-

(a) refers to any device or group of interconnected or related devices, one or more of which, pursuant to a program, performs automated or interactive processing of data;
(b) covers any type of device with data processing capabilities including, computers and mobile phones;
(c) consists of hardware and software which may include input, output and storage components that may stand alone or be connected in a network or other similar devices; and
(d) includes computer data storage devices or media;

"Consumer" means every person or organization who enters into computer based purchase, lease, transfer, maintenance and consultancy service agreements with a computer service provider and the customer and agent of the consumer and includes bank account holders who carry financial cards;

"content data" means the actual information or message sent across during a communication session;

"Counterfeit Card" means a bank card, credit card or a payment card which is fictitious, altered, or forged and includes any facsimile or false representation, deception, or component of such a card, or any such card which is stolen, obtained as part of a scheme to defraud, or otherwise unlawfully obtained, and which mayor may not be embossed with account information or an issuer's information:

"Countering Violent Extremism (CVE) Program" includes any-
(a) intervention designed to counter the persistence of violent radicalization to reduce the incidence of violent activities, change the behaviour of violent extremists, and counter the negative extreme groups while promoting core national values; and
(b) also any program that seeks to identify the underlying causes of radicalization (social, cultural, religious and economic) and develop strategies that provide solutions and also introduce measures to change the attitudes and perceptions of potential recruits, including providing vocational training of prisoners and means of sustainable livelihood and reintegration of reformed extremists to their families and communities;

"Credit" includes a cash loan, or any other financial information;

"Credit Card" means any instrument, token, device, or card, whether known as a charge card or by any other similar name, issued with or without a fee by an issuer for the use of the cardholder in obtaining goods, services, or anything else of value on credit from a creditor or for use in an automated banking device to obtain money or any of the services offered through the devices;

"Creditor" means a person or company that agrees or is authorised by an issuer to supply goods, services, or anything else of value and to accept payment by use of a bank card, credit card, payment card for the supply of such goods, services or anything else of value to the cardholder;

"Critical infrastructure" means, systems and assets which are so vital to the country that the destruction of such systems and assets would have an impact on the security, national economic security, national public health and safety of the country;

"Counterfeit access device" means counterfeit, fictitious, altered, or forged, or an identifiable component of an access device or a counterfeit access device;

"cyberstalking" a course of conduct directed at a specific person that would cause a reasonable person to feel fear;
"cybersquatting" means the acquisition of a domain name over the internet in bad faith to profit, mislead, destroy reputation, and deprive others from registering the same, if such a domain name is:
(a) similar, identical, or confusingly similar to an existing trademark registered with the appropriate government agency at the time of the domain name registration:

(b) identical or in any way similar with the name of a person other than the registrant, in case of a personal name; and

(c) acquired without right or with intellectual property interests in it.

"damage" means any impairment to a computer or the integrity or availability of data, program, system or information that-

(a) causes financial loss;

(b) modifies or impairs or potentially modifies or impairs the medical examination, diagnosis, treatment or care of one or more persons;

(c) causes or threatens physical injury or death to any person; or

(d) threatens public health or public safety;

"data" means representations of information or of concepts that are being prepared or have been prepared in a form suitable for use in a computer;

"database" means digitally organized collection of data for one or more purposes which allows easy access, management and update of data;

"device" means any object or equipment that has been designed to do a particular job or whose mechanical or electrical workings are controlled or monitored by a microprocessor;

"electronic communication" includes communications in electronic format, instant messages, short message service (SMS), e-mail, video, voice mails, multimedia message service (MMS), Fax and pager;

"electronic device" means a device which accomplishes its purpose electronically and this includes, computer systems, telecommunication devices, smart phones, access cards, credit cards, debit cards, loyalty cards etc.;

"electronic record" means a record generated, communicated, received or stored by electronic, magnetic, optical or other means in an information system or for transmission from one information system to another;

"Electronic transfer of fund" means any transfer of funds which is initiated by a person by way of instruction, authorisation or order to a bank to debit or credit an account maintained with that bank through electronic means and includes point of sales transfers, automated teller machine transactions, direct deposits or withdrawal of funds, transfer initiated by telephone, internet and card payment;

"Expired Card" means a card which is no longer valid because the term shown of it has expired;

"Financial Institution" includes any individual, body, association or group of persons, whether corporate or unincorporated which carries on the business of investment and securities, a discount house, finance company and money brokerage whose principal object includes factoring project financing equipment leasing, debt administration, fund management, private ledger services, investment management, local purchase order financing, export finance, project consultancy, financial consultancy, pension fund management, insurance institutions, debt factorization and conversion firms, dealer, clearing and settlement companies, legal practitioners, hotels, casinos, bureau de change, supermarkets and such other businesses as the Central Bank or appropriate regulatory authorities may, from time to time, designate;

"Financial Transaction" means,
(a) a transaction which in any way involves movement of funds by wire or other electronic means;

(b) involves one or more monetary instruments;

(c) involves the transfer of title to any real or personal property;

"function" includes logic, control, arithmetic, deletion, storage, retrieval and communication or telecommunication to, from or within a computer;

"Identity Theft" means, the stealing of somebody else personal information to obtain goods and services through electronic based transactions;

"Infrastructure Terminal" includes terminals which includes GSM Phones that can be used to access bank or any other sensitive information, Point of sales terminals (POS) and all other Card Acceptor Devices that are in use now or may be introduced in the future;

"Interception" in relation to a function of a computer system or communications network, includes listening to or recording of communication data of a computer or acquiring the substance, meaning or purport of such and any act capable of blocking or preventing any of these functions;

"Issuer" includes a financial institution which or any other entity who is authorised by the Central Bank to issue a payment card;

"Law Enforcement Agencies" includes any agency for the time being responsible for implementation and enforcement of the provisions of this Act;

"Minister" means the Attorney General of the Federation;

"Modification" means deletion, deterioration, alteration, restriction or suppression of data within computer systems or networks, including data transfer from a computer system by any means.

"network" means a collection of hardware components and computers interconnected by communications channels that allow sharing of resources and information;

"Payment Card" means any instrument, token, device, or card, or known by any other similar name, and encoded with a stated money value and issued with or without a fee by an issuer for use of the cardholder in obtaining goods, services, or anything else of value, except money;

"person" includes an individual, body corporate, organisation or group of persons;

"President" means the President, Commander in Chief of the Armed Forces of the Federal Republic of Nigeria;

"Phishing" means the criminal and fraudulent process of attempting to acquire sensitive information such as usernames, passwords and credit card details, by masquerading as a trustworthy entity in an electronic communication through e-mails or instant messaging either in form of an email from what appears from your bank asking a user to change his or her password or reveal his or her identity so that such information can later be used to defraud the user;

"Purchasing Forged Electronic" means a Credit or Debit Transfer Instruments such as Credit Card, Debit Card, Smart Card, ATM or other related electronic payment system devices;

"Receives" or "Receiving" means acquiring possession, title or control or accepting a card as security for credit;

"Revoked Card" means a card which is no longer valid because permission to use it has been suspended or terminated by the issuer, whether on its own or on the request of the cardholder;

"Service provider" means-
(a) any public or private entity that provides to users of its services the ability to communicate by means of a computer system, electronic communication devices, mobile networks; and

(b) any other entity that processes or stores computer data on behalf of such communication service or users of such service;

"Sexually explicit conduct" includes at least the following real or simulated acts-

(a) sexual intercourse, including genital genital, oral genital, anal genital or oral anal, between children, or between an adult and a child, of the same or opposite sex;

(b) bestiality;

(c) masturbation;

(d) sadistic or masochistic abuse in a sexual context; or

(e) lascivious exhibition of the genitals or the pubic area of a child. It is not relevant whether the conduct depicted is real or simulated;

"Spamming" means an abuse of electronic messaging systems to indiscriminately send unsolicited bulk messages to individuals and corporate organizations;

"Traffic" means to sell, transfer, distribute, dispense, or otherwise dispose of property or to buy, receive, possess, obtain control of, or use property with the intent to sell, transfer, distribute, dispense, or otherwise dispose of such property; and

"traffic data" means any computer data relating to a communication by means of a computer system or network, generated by a computer system that formed a part in the chain of communication, indicating the communication's origin, destination, route, time, date, size, duration, or type of underlying service.
